Abstract

A three dimensional model for hydrodynamics and sediment transport (SAM-3D) is applied to the «baie de Seine» area (English Channel) in order to simulate the turbid structures (turbidity maximum in the Seine estuary and turbid plume of the Seine river). This model is able to satisfactorily reproduce the high suspended matter concentrations observed in the turbidity maximum (a few g·L –1) as well as the increasing suspended matter concentrations in the river plume (few mg·L –1) along the annual cycle. This study gives an insight on the contribution of the Seine river inputs to deposits of fine particles in the eastern baie de Seine.
